Project Manager, Ho Chi Minh Mace combines global delivery consultancy experience to unlock potential in every person or project and redefine the boundaries of ambition. Our values shape the way we consult and define the people we want to join us on our journey. The project: This is a complex, large scale, production facility project that includes warehouse, office, and staff amenities working with an amazing client and talented Mace team. This project will be of incredibly high-quality standards in a heavily regulated environment, suiting people with similar project experience that operate with the highest integrity and professionalism. You’ll be responsible for: Leads project delivery in line with the Project Plan, coordinating teams, consultants and contractors to meet defined KPIs. Monitors progress, budget and risks, driving proactive mitigation and maintaining accurate project records. Ensures safety, quality and compliance through robust systems aligned with the Mace Way. Manages procurement, project changes and documentation to support timely, effective delivery. Coordinates design, programme integration and stakeholder communication to achieve project objectives. Promotes digital excellence, sustainability and continuous improvement, contributing to Mace’s net‑zero ambitions. You’ll need to have: Architectural or Engineering degree with experience delivering small to medium projects and engaging diverse stakeholders. Strong knowledge of construction methodologies, project management practices and industry regulations. Growing capability in budgeting, commercial controls and procurement. Holds relevant technical qualifications or progressing toward professional accreditation (e.g., MCIOB, MAPM, MRICS).
